ITAT Mumbai Affirms Agreement Date as Start of Holding Period for Capital Gains
In a ruling that reinforces a significant and well-settled legal principle, the Income Tax Appellate Tribunal (ITAT), Mumbai Bench, in the case of Braj Kishore Singh Vs Assessing Officer Internatinal Tax, has held that the holding period of a property for the purpose of calculating capital gains commences from the date of the ‘agreement for sale’, not from the subsequent date of possession.
